As of 2010-2014, the per capita income of 98243 Zip Code is $50,227, which is much higher than the state average of $31,233 and is much higher than the national average of $28,555. 98243 Zip Code median household income is $63,125, which has shrunk by 20.63% since 2000. The median household income growth rate is much lower than the state average rate of 31.72% and is much lower than the national average rate of 27.36%. On average 98243 Zip Code residents spend 18.6 minutes per day commuting to work, which is lower than the state average of 25.9 minutes and is lower than the national average of 25.7 minutes.
